A graduate in his first professional job is attempting to climb the ladder quickly without consideration for others' perspectives or feelings. He won't tolerate anyone getting in his way.
 
  Based on this employee's attitude, what type of conflict style will he likely use in the workplace?
  A) Competing
  B) Collaborating
  C) Compromising
  D) Accommodating

Answer to Question 1

A
Explanation: A) A competing conflict style is described by a high level of assertiveness and a low level of cooperation and this seems to match this employee's one track mind of achievement at everyone else's expense.

Answer to Question 4

A
Explanation: A) Our cognitive frames are shaped by far more than what department or team we work in, but rather are a combination of many life experiences. Those on the same team or in the same department may frame some issues similarly, but their frames will not be the same on all issues. In conflict resolution, we should be aware that individuals see things differently because this can help us understand how they are viewing the conflict.

Bisphosphonates were first developed in the nineteenth century. They were first investigated for use in disorders of bone metabolism in the 1960s. They are now used clinically for the treatment of osteoporosis, Paget's disease, bone metastasis, multiple myeloma, and other conditions that feature bone fragility.
